Output 64aa18c0d32023353614aff2c415be7287e4e1b12483906349681b7a6c326c95:0

value
35686000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e4bd30a4561671cf78199a7b1e3a85cd5f8e2fce OP_EQUAL
address
MUkcwKVivzFrXsShPcRcNVBvYuejSpP3Ni
transaction
64aa18c0d32023353614aff2c415be7287e4e1b12483906349681b7a6c326c95
spent
true